About the role
We are hiring our second GTM operations teammate: a hands-on GTM Engineer who owns the execution layer of our revenue systems. You will report to the manager of Revenue Operations and work as the front-line builder and operator for a GTM org of 30, running on one of the most modern, AI-native revenue stacks anywhere.
This is an AI-first seat. You will work with Claude/Cursor/Codex and agentic tooling every day, and we expect AI leverage to make you dramatically more productive than a traditional ops hire. It is also a service seat: real people need real help daily, and you will be the first call when a rep is blocked. You know what a BDR's morning looks like, what an AE needs mid-deal, and what an AM checks before a renewal call, and you genuinely enjoy dropping what you are doing to unblock them, running down a minor technical issue, and getting them back to selling. If you want to build systems AND love being the person who unblocks a team, this role is for you.
Key responsibilities
Recurring, high-volume execution & systems support:
Create target lists and audiences for outbound, campaigns, and marketing programs, ensuring swift, and effective sales execution
Build novel, custom, agentic workflows to enable the BDR, AE, and AM teams across pre-sales, sales, and post-sales
Run data enrichment, hygiene, and processing: cleaning, dedupe, and enrichment pipelines in Clay and Salesforce
Provide daily systems support, user management, and front-line issue resolution across the GTM stack: Salesforce, Gong, Outreach, Apollo, Clay, Common Room, etc
Execute territory refinements and CRM build work prioritized by RevOps & sales leadership
Work closely with sales leadership and operations to refine and improve GTM processes through system design and enablement
Ensure new hires are setup and fluent in their tools
Systems you'll manage directly:
Outreach (sales engagement), Common Room (community and signal tracking), Gumloop (agentic workflows), and Default (inbound lead routing)
What we're looking for
3 to 5 years in GTM, revenue, or sales operations at a B2B software company; usage-based or PLG experience is a plus
Fluent in how revenue teams actually run: the day-to-day of BDRs (lists, sequences, meeting handoffs), AEs (pipeline hygiene, deal cycles, forecasting), and AMs (renewals, expansion, account health), so everything you build and every fix you make fits how sellers really work
Hands-on operator of a modern GTM stack: Salesforce administration (declarative: flows, permissions, reports), a sales engagement platform, and an enrichment tool (Clay strongly preferred)
Comfortable with APIs and webhooks; you can wire two systems together and debug a broken sync without waiting for engineering. SQL is a plus, software engineering is not required
Fluent with AI tools as a builder, not just a chat user: you use Claude, Cursor, or similar to script, automate, and ship fast
A systems-design mind with a service heart: empathetic and support-minded, you see the process behind the ticket, you still answer the ticket fast, and you will happily set aside deep work to unblock an AE or research a small technical issue through to resolution
High ownership and low ego: unglamorous data work done precisely is how revenue teams win
